Industry Experience: We looked for contractors with a proven, decades-long track record in the local area. Navigating Colorado's specific soil and moisture challenges requires deep, localized knowledge rather than guesswork.

Comprehensive Service Offerings: A great contractor should offer a full suite of structural and moisture-control solutions. This ensures that related issues, such as yard grading or concrete repair, are handled by a single dedicated team.

Transparency and Pricing: Free inspections and clear, no-obligation estimates are essential for budgeting. We prioritized businesses that break down all costs clearly and charge reasonable prices.

Customer Feedback and Reliability: We evaluated how well these companies communicate, honor warranties, and adhere to project timelines. Consistent professionalism and clean-up practices were vital markers of a trustworthy service provider.

How much does basement waterproofing cost in Denver?

Waterproofing in Denver typically costs between $2,000 and $8,000 for standard projects. The final cost still depends on the severity of the moisture issues and the solution you choose.

Waterproofing MethodAverage Cost
Interior Sealant/Paint$2 – $9 per square foot
Drainage System (Interior/Exterior)$2,000 – $6,000
Yard Grading$600 – $3,300 per project
Exterior Excavation & Waterproofing$8,000 – $15,000+
